* {
	margin: 0;
	padding: 0;
}
body {
	background-color: #F0F3E6;
}
.maxwidth {
	max-width:1000px;
    width:expression(document.body.clientWidth > 1000 ? "1000px": "auto" );
	margin-right: auto;
	margin-left: auto;
}
.header {
	background-image: url(../images/header.jpg);
	height: 162px;
	width: 1000px;
}
h1 {
	font-size: 16px;
	font-weight: bold;
	color: #330066;
}
h2 {
	font-size: 14px;
	font-weight: bold;
	color: #330066;
}
ul {
	margin-left: 20px;
}

.headings {
	font-size: 12px;
	font-weight: bold;
	color: #996600;
}

.padding-top-60 {
	padding-top: 60px;
	width: 490px;
}
.left_nav {
	background-color: #F4EDF6;
	padding-left: 15px;
}
#content {
	padding-right: 10px;
	padding-bottom: 10px;
	padding-left: 10px;
	padding-top: 10px;
}
#content h1{
	color: 330066;
	font-size: 20px;


}#content h2 {
	color: #330066;
	font-size: 18px;
}
a:link {
	color: #74833F;
	text-decoration: none;
	font-weight: bold;
}
a:active {
	color: #74833F;
	text-decoration: none;
	font-weight: bold;
}
a:visited {
	color: #74833F;
	text-decoration: none;
	font-weight: bold;
}
a:hover {
	color: #74833F;
}



#content .author{
	color: #cc99cc;
	font-size: 12px;
	padding-bottom: 10px;
	padding-top: 10px;

}



#centernav  {
	padding-left: 10px;
	background-color: #F4EDF5;

}
#centernav  a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#C684B4;
	text-decoration: none;
	font-weight: bold;
}#centernav  a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#C684B4;
	text-decoration: none;
	font-weight: bold;
}

#centernav a: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
#centernav a: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}#topnav  {
	background-color: #D19CC3;

}
#topnav  a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}#topnav  a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
}

#topnav a:hover {
   font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}#topnav a: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#000000;
	text-decoration: none;
	font-weight: bold;
}
#featured {
	padding-right: 10px;
	padding-left: 10px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#666666;
}
#featured h2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	color: #D6AED7;
	text-decoration: none;
	font-weight: bold;
}
#featured a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#330066;
	text-decoration: none;
	font-weight: bold;
	width: 60px;
}
#featured a:hover active {
	color: #000000;
}
.image_right {
	margin-right: 10px;
}
#headernav a: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#1A171B;
	text-decoration: none;
	font-weight: bold;
}
#headernav a:hover active {
	color: #000000;
}
#headernav a: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#1A171B;
	text-decoration: none;
	font-weight: bold;
}

.clear_left {
	clear: left;
}
.purpleback {
	background-color: #9900FF;
	width: 1px;
}
.padding_left {
	padding-left: 15px;
}

#home-center {
	font-size: 12px;
	color: #666666;
}
#footer {
	background-image: url(../images/footer.jpg);
	width: 1000px;
}
.float_right {
	float: right;
}
.search {
	background-image: url(../images/search.gif);
	background-position: right;
	background-repeat: no-repeat;
	height: 61px;
	width: 239px;
	float: right;
	padding-bottom: 62px;
}
.search-place {
	padding-left: 8px;
	padding-top: 62px;
}

.clear_both {
	clear: both;
}
.float_left {
	float: left;
}

p {
	margin-bottom: 10px;
}
html {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
}
.width80 {
	maxwidth: 120px;
}
.width90 {
	maxwidth: 140px;
}.width400 {
	width: 400px;
}
.background {
	background-image: url(../images/footer.jpg);
}
.width70 {
	maxwidth: 110px;
}.width_430 {
	WIDTH: 420px
}

.ico-journey {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
}.ico-book {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
	background-position: 0px -44px;
}.ico-childhealth {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
		background-position: 0px -88px;
}.ico-childdisc {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-132px;
}.ico-childedu {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-176px;
}.ico-childnutri {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-220px;
}.ico-familyfun {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-264px;
}.ico-parcomm {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-308px;
}.ico-womhealth {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-352px;
}.ico-fatherhood {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-396px;
}.ico-spirit {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-440px;
}.ico-altern {
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-484px;
}.ico-photo{
	background-image: url(../images/homeicons/homeicons.gif);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-528px;
}

/* dark icons */

.ico-journey-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
}.ico-book-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
	background-position: 0px -44px;
}.ico-childhealth-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
		background-position: 0px -88px;
}.ico-childdisc-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-132px;
}.ico-childedu-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-176px;
}.ico-childnutri-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-220px;
}.ico-familyfun-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-264px;
}.ico-parcomm-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-308px;
}.ico-womhealth-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-352px;
}.ico-fatherhood-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-396px;
}.ico-spirit-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-440px;
}.ico-altern-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-484px;
}.ico-photo-dark {
	background-image: url(../images/homeicons/homeicons-dark.jpg);
	height: 44px;
	width: 45px;
	float: left;
	margin-right: 5px;
			background-position: 0px -528px;
}

/* important to all*/
.left-padding-5 {
	padding-left: 5px;
}
.PaddingLeft {
padding-left:10px;
}

.leftf {
	float: left;
}.list_middle_430 {
	WIDTH: 420px
}.2ndmainlink {
	FONT-WEIGHT: bold;
	FONT-SIZE: 12px;
	COLOR: #666666;
	FONT-FAMILY: Verdana;
	TEXT-DECORATION: underline;
}
.2ndmainlink A {
	FONT-WEIGHT: bold;
	FONT-SIZE: 12px;
	COLOR: #330066;
	FONT-FAMILY: Verdana;
	TEXT-DECORATION: none;

}
.2ndmainlink:hover {
	COLOR: #110022;
	TEXT-DECORATION: underline;
}
/* detail page styles */

.back-products {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 134px;
	margin: 2px;
}
.back-images {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 80px;
	margin: 2px;
}
.back-articles {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 273px;
	margin: 2px;
}
.back-message {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 106px;
	margin: 2px;
}
.back-website {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 218px;
	margin: 2px;
}
.back-map {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
 background-position:;
	background-position: 52px;
	margin: 2px;
}
.back-addreview {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 318px;
	margin: 2px;
}
.back-review {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 192px;
	margin: 2px;
}
.back-print {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 22px;
	margin: 2px;
}
.back-mail-to-friend {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 106px;
	margin: 2px;
}
.back-bookmark {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
	background-position:;
	background-position: 244px;
	margin: 2px;
}
.back-spam {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 164px;
	margin: 2px;
}
.back-shortlist {
	background-image: url(../images/icons/icons.gif);
	height: 22px;
	width: 22px;
    background-position:;
	background-position: 295px;
	margin: 2px;
}.Padding5 {
padding:5px;
}
.Color3 {
	BACKGROUND-COLOR: #fff
}
.Color3 A {
	COLOR: #666;
}
.Color4 {
	background-color: #FAF9F5;
	color: #333333;
}
.Color4 A {
	COLOR: #429fb3;
}
.Color5 {
	background-color: #E9E0CF;
	color: #333333;
}
.Color5 A {
	COLOR: #f90;
}
.Color6 {
	BACKGROUND-COLOR: #d5e4f0
}
.Color6 A {
	COLOR: #666;
}#additional_images {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	PADDING-BOTTOM: 0px;
	MARGIN: 3px 0px 0px;
	PADDING-TOP: 3px
}
#additional_images A {
	DISPLAY: none
}
#additional_images UL {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	PADDING-BOTTOM: 0px;
	MARGIN: 0px;
	PADDING-TOP: 0px
}
#additional_images LI P {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	PADDING-BOTTOM: 0px;
	MARGIN: 0px;
	PADDING-TOP: 0px
}
#additional_images LI {
	PADDING-RIGHT: 3px;
	PADDING-LEFT: 0px;
	FLOAT: left;
	PADDING-BOTTOM: 1px;
	MARGIN: 0px 3px 1px 0px;
	PADDING-TOP: 0px;
	LIST-STYLE-TYPE: none
}.blue_button {
	FONT-SIZE: 9px;
	COLOR: #333;
	FONT-FAMILY: Verdana
}
.blue_button {
	FONT-SIZE: 9px;
	COLOR: #333;
	FONT-FAMILY: Verdana
}
.font11 {
	font-size: 11px;
}a:link {
	color: #6B894B;
	font-size: 12px;
	text-decoration: none;
	font-weight: bold;
}
a:active {
	color: #6B894B;
	font-size: 12px;
	text-decoration: none;
	font-weight: bold;
}
a:visited {
	color: #6B894B;
	font-size: 12px;
	text-decoration: none;
	font-weight: bold;
}
a:hover {
	color: #331A00;
	text-decoration: underline;
}

